Description

Deceptively spacious and much improved detached family home offering light, well planned and laid out accommodation over three floors, situated in the heart of the sought after village of Pontesbury. To the ground floor, the entrance hall gives access off to a guest cloakroom whilst the living room benefits from a multi fuel burning stove and has a delightful aspect over the gardens. The kitchen diner is of a good size with the kitchen area being fitted with a modern range of units with integral appliances. A useful rear entrance porch, with doors leading out to the garden. To the first floor there are three bedrooms and the main family bathroom. To the top floor is the principal bedroom which also offers a good sized en suite shower room. Outside the property has driveway parking for several vehicles and the delightful well manicured gardens, and orchard area with fruit trees, ornamental trees and soft fruit.

Pleasantly situated within the popular village of Pontesbury and is within walking distance of a number of amenities including restaurants, local shops, churches, medical, dental and veterinary surgery and schools. The property is located close to Pontesford Hill with its wonderful walks and spectacular views. A more comprehensive range of facilities are available in the county town of Shrewsbury. There is easy access to the A5 which links through to Oswestry in the north, Telford to the east and onto the M54 and national motorway network. There is also a rail service available in Shrewsbury town centre.
